WebIn order to successfully conduct research with the State land records the researcher must first identify the full name of the land purchaser, the applicant, the warrantee, or patentee; the county in which the land was owned; and the approximate date of the transaction. WebApr 15, 2024 · The specific way that you do this varies by location. Some counties have online databases that you can search. Others require you to call their offices to request property information. While contacting the county clerk is one way to find out who owns a property in Pennsylvania, it isn’t always reliable.
